The Wonder of Bees with Martha Kearney

The Wonder of Bees with Martha Kearney (2014)

EndedDocumentary showNature

Series which follows Martha Kearney's bee-keeping year and explores the science, art and culture of the honeybee, the most ingenious insect known to humankind.
